KYIV, Ukraine — The Ukrainian army on Thursday mentioned the southern port metropolis of Mariupol was now inside attain of its weapons, suggesting with out offering particulars that Kyiv has longer vary weapons at its disposal than it did even a month in the past.

“At this stage, we are able to solely say that distance is a really relative notion,” Natalia Humeniuk, the spokeswoman for the Ukrainian army southern command mentioned in an look on nationwide tv, including, “The Mariupol entrance will not be completely unattainable for us.”

The deliberate vagueness of her feedback have been in step with Ukraine’s curiosity in preserving Moscow guessing about what weapons Kyiv has obtainable and making Russian forces really feel unsafe in all places within the territory they occupy.

For 2 consecutive nights, explosions have rocked Mariupol, together with blasts close to the airport and round a metal plant. Petro Andriushchenko, an adviser to town’s exiled mayor, mentioned on Thursday that Ukrainian forces directed three “surgically exact” hits on concentrations of Russian forces.

However Mariupol falls simply exterior the vary of the precision-guided munitions offered to Ukraine by its Western allies: HIMARS and M270 A number of Launch Rocket Programs, which may attain targets round 43 miles away.

That raised questions on whether or not the assault was the work of saboteurs behind enemy traces or if Ukraine might need acquired the sort of long-range weapon it has mentioned it wanted to assault Russian command facilities, ammunition depots and provide traces deep in enemy territory.

Ukraine has used assault drones to hit targets at a far better distance than its different weapons permit. Given the sample of strikes and the feedback from the Ukrainian army, hypothesis was swirling that it might have acquired a brand new weapon.

The New Voice of Ukraine, a Kyiv-based digital information web site, mentioned it was attainable {that a} domestically produced weapon was used to hit Mariupol, utilizing a heavy a number of rocket launch system primarily based on the Soviet Smerch design that would have a spread of greater than 80 miles.

A lot of the hypothesis has additionally centered on the attainable use of Floor Launched Small Diameter Bombs, which have a spread of about 94 miles.

The Pentagon press secretary, Brig. Gen. Pat S. Ryder, said earlier this month that the United States would be providing the weapons to present Ukrainian forces a longer-range functionality “that can allow them once more to conduct operations in protection of their nation and to take again their sovereign territory in Russian occupied areas.” It was thought, nonetheless, that these weapons might take months to reach on the battlefield.
